Swedish Yule cookies

Ingredients for 1 servings:

  • 140 g butter
  • 1 pinch of salt
  • 70 g sugar
  • 2 egg yolks
  • 220 g flour
  • 1 pinch of baking powder
  • 1 egg white
  • 50 g cinnamon sugar

Instructions

Working time approx. 30 minutes; Rest time approx. 2 hours; Cooking/baking time approx. 30 minutes; Total time approx. 3 hours

Tea biscuits, makes about 50 pieces

Cream the butter with sugar, egg yolk, and salt until fluffy. Sift the flour and baking powder together and knead into a dough. Wrap the shortcrust pastry in foil and chill. Knead individual portions of the dough until smooth. Roll out the dough to about 3 mm thick and cut out round cookies with a diameter of 6 cm. Place the cookies on baking paper, brush with beaten egg white, and sprinkle with cinnamon sugar. Bake the Yule cookies at 160°C (top/bottom heat) for about 10-15 minutes until golden brown.
